Your Opportunity Your role as a senior contributor on our professional Architecture team is to work independently to assist clients through the creation of fiscally responsible, award-winning designs. This position focuses on multiple construction projects and your experience ensures that you are quite familiar with construction plans, specifications, estimates and building codes. You will be reviewing the construction of projects with green architecture sensibility as your goals. You will lead the construction stage, while mentoring others and collaborating with team members to contribute to the final deliverables as required under instruction from the Project Leader. Your Key Responsibilities Perform quality control/constructability reviews on drawings and specifications prior to issuing documents for permit/tender. Attend site meetings, oversee activities on multiple construction projects & prepare site reports. Provide progress reports to owner on a regular basis. Review shop drawings, answer Contractor requests for information and issue Contract Changes. Mentor design and technical staff on construction and Practice issues. Provide updates and reports to Principal-In-Charge/management.
